CBD Products in Belgium: Legality, Availability, and Uses

The legal landscape surrounding CBD products in Belgium is fairly straightforward. While cannabis remains illegal for recreational use, CBD derived from industrial hemp with THC levels below 0.2% is legalized for sale and consumption. Consequently, a wide variety of CBD products are accessible in Belgium, such as oils, edibles, topicals, and even cosmetics.{

CBD users in Belgium often utilize these products for potential therapeutic benefits, including managing anxiety and stress. Additionally, some people turn to CBD for soothing discomfort. However, it's important to note that scientific research on the efficacy of CBD is ongoing to fully understand its potential benefits.

While Belgian consumers seem to experience few adverse effects from CBD, it's always best to seek medical advice if you have any health concerns.
